Durack Civil is a leading civil construction contractor delivering projects throughout Queensland, New South Wales and the Northern Territory. With a growing fleet of modern equipment and a strong pipeline of work, we are seeking an experienced Plant Manager to take ownership of our plant division and drive operational excellence across the business.
This is a hands-on leadership role responsible for maximising fleet utilisation, managing compliance and maintenance systems, supporting project delivery teams, and building a high-performing plant culture.
About the Role
Reporting to the Operations Manager, you will be responsible for the strategic and day-to-day management of Durack Civil's plant fleet, operators, subcontractor plant and supporting systems. You will work closely with project teams to ensure the right equipment is available, compliant, cost-effective and ready to perform when required. (Plant Manager | Word)
Key Responsibilities
Lead and manage all aspects of plant operations across the business
Oversee fleet maintenance, servicing schedules and asset lifecycle planning
Drive plant utilisation and monitor fleet performance across projects
Manage plant procurement, disposals and capital expenditure recommendations
Negotiate plant hire arrangements and supplier agreements
Oversee subcontractor plant onboarding and compliance requirements
Develop and improve plant tracking, servicing and maintenance systems
Conduct plant audits and ensure compliance with relevant legislation and company standards
Lead operator onboarding, inductions and competency management processes
Support tender submissions through plant planning and pricing input
Promote a strong culture of safety, accountability and continuous improvement
Ensure compliance with Chain of Responsibility (CoR) obligations and transport requirements.
About You
To be successful, you will have:
Significant experience managing plant and equipment within the civil construction industry
Strong commercial acumen and understanding of plant costing and utilisation
Demonstrated experience managing large fleets and maintenance programs
Knowledge of CoR requirements, heavy vehicle legislation and plant compliance
Strong leadership and people management skills
Excellent planning, organisational and negotiation abilities
Experience implementing and improving operational systems and processes
A practical, solutions-focused approach with a willingness to be involved at ground level.
